Stock Screening Made Simple: Use This Tool
ZACKS· 2026-03-26 21:31
Core Insights - Stock screening is a valuable tool for investors to navigate the vast array of investment options available, similar to using a grocery list to efficiently find items in a store [1][11] - The screening process can be complex and overwhelming, as different investors have varying preferences and strategies [2][12] Screening Parameters - Screening parameters serve as the essential components for investors, allowing them to filter out irrelevant information and tailor their searches according to specific investing styles [3] Value Investing - Value investors can utilize parameters such as Price-to-Earnings (P/E) ratio, Price-to-Sales (P/S) ratio, and Price-to-Book (P/B) ratio to identify stocks that are attractively valued [4] Momentum Investing - Momentum investing focuses on stocks that have experienced recent buying pressure, with parameters including price change over the last month, average volume, and price relative to the 52-week high-low range [5] Growth Investing - Growth-oriented strategies target companies expected to achieve above-average sales and earnings growth, with key parameters including last year's earnings and sales growth rates, as well as expected growth rates for the current and next year [6][7] Income Investing - Income-focused investing emphasizes dividend-paying stocks, which are often more stable and represent mature companies sharing profits with shareholders [8] - Parameters for identifying dividend-paying stocks include current dividend yield and the 5-year historical dividend growth rate [9]
